Meridian Option 11C Difference Between 11,11E,11C Option 11 2 CPU Cards: CPU/CONF (Conference Loop) and TDS/DTR (Tone Digit Switch/Digit Tone Rxer) occupied 2 slots. 1 Expansion cabinet 224 Ports(including Trunk & Digital cards) Connectivity of expansion cabinet to main cabinet: Copper Connectivity only Max distance bet main & expansion is 2.12 m. Max 10 slots for cards excluding power supply. Operates on AC. Connection from 1st slot of expansion cabinet to anywhere between 2 & 9 of main cabinet. Option 11E System core ( contains cartridge containing customer data base) 384 ports 2 expansion cabinets Copper or fiber connectivity for the expansion cabinets to the main. Max distance between 10 m.

Fiber Connectivity : MFI Card(Main Fiber Interface) & EFI Card(Expansion Fiber Interface) Rls 22 & 23.

Option 11C SSC (Small System Card) Motorola 68040(CPU/16 MB of DRAM) S/W Daughterboard Two slots for fiber expansion Max of 4 expansion cabinets 700 ports Rls 24 & 25 If connecting a single expansion cabinet require a single daughterboard If connecting a 2 expansion cabinet require a dual daughterboard If connecting a 3 expansion cabinet require a single & dual daughterboard Max distance between main & expansion can be 3 Km. General Details EPABX TDM Switch Total 10 Slots Slot 10 Meridian Mail (MM) SSC contains Dongle & S/W Daughterboard Dongle Lithium Battery storage Contains Site ID (System) & Auxiliary ID (Up gradation) Rls 23 & 24 32 MB S/W Daughterboard Rls 24.24 & 25 onwards 48 MB S/W Daughterboard During up gradation we need to change the S/W Daughterboard which upgrades the Flash part of the Memory. SSC Card: Occupies one slot can insert PCMCIA Card A: & B: drive - A: Up gradation B: Backup When a card is inserted, the time slots(Loop) is taken from the Back plane. Loop 29 & 30 are reserved for conference (By default Logical & not physical) One Loop 30 time slots Loop 11 to 28 Expansion cabinet (Reserved) ISM Incremental S/W Management Digital Line Card 16 ports each port as a TN(Terminal Number) Loop Shelf Card Unit (l s c u) DN Directory Number (extn No)

SSC Card 3 Serial ports Port 0, 1 ,2 - Maintenance (To view ACD,CDR & Login Purpose) Ethernet Connectivity assign a IP (PC) CDR (Call Detail reporting) Log of outgoing & incoming calls ACD (Automatic Call Distribution) automatically distributes the call depending on the most idle agent suitable for call center need to capture the reports. BASIC CARDS DLC: Digital Line Card 16 Ports (-28 V DC) supports only Nortel digital phones FALC: Flexible Analog Line Card 16 Ports (-40 V DC) MWLC: Message Waiting Line Card 16 Ports XCOT-I: Trunk Card India Modified 8 Ports COT/PPM: Trunk Card 8 Ports UNVTRK: Universal Trunk Card 8 Ports PRI: Primary Rate Interface (2 types) 30B + 1D: E1 & 23B + 1D: T1 DTI: Digital Trunk Interface (2 types) 30 Channels: E1 & 24 Channels: T1 MIRAN: Meridian Integrated RAN MICB: Meridian Integrated Conference Bridge E & M: Ear & Mouth Card PRI Card Need to configure a D-Channel EURO, Q Sig, ESS4, SL1 Protocols Between switches by which data can be sent thru D Channel Outband Signaling Signaling has a separate channel (CCS- Common Channel Signaling) All signals are passed via D-Channel The line remains idle as long as acknowledgement is not rxed although the call is placed

DTI Card In band Signaling Channel Associated Signaling (CAS) No Protocol Two types of Condition: Idle & Seize Code - should match in remote end All signals passed in the same Voice Channel Once the call is placed the line is seized & that extn becomes busy for Other Callers.

MITG (Meridian Integrated (IP) Telephony Gateway) Voice over IP Extending ur voice in network over Internet Two Types : (1) Line side (using IP Phone over WAN) (2) Trunk side (Connect two meridian over Ethernet) ITG TDM to convert IP Packets & Compresses data ITG 1.0 Works with Rls X.11 onwards ITG 1.0 8 simultaneous calls occupies 2 slots ITG 2.0 24 simultaneous calls occupies 2 slots OTM 2.0 or later ITG 3.0 32 simultaneous calls occupies 1 slot OTM(Optivity Telephony Management) 2.0 or later MC (Media Conversion) Card MAT (Meridian Administration Tools) 6.1 or later PC with Windows 95 or later

Has 2 Ethernet ports, one is for E LAN & one is for T LAN Connection MAT is connected to E LAN of Meridian & E LAN of MITG Dongle ID is there for ITG 1.0 but ITG 2.0 & 3.0 does not require Dongle ID. Supports CDR (Call Detail reporting) & SNMP Alarm Traps

Prerequisites For Configuring ITG Stable & dedicated IP Address for ITG Card Node IP address (T LAN IP address on the ITG) Management LAN Gateway IP address Management subnet mask Voice LAN gateway IP Voice subnet mask Keycode of MITG Card Dongle ID of MITG Card MAC Address of MITG Card Line Card No ITG 1.0 Version Does not require a Meridian on the other end. It requires only a IP Phone.

24 ports per card (ITG 2.0) & 32 ports per card (ITG 3.0) Supports up to 96 Internet Telephones per card (Virtual Connection within LAN)

Trunk Side Connects two Meridian over Intranet & ordinary phones are enough for communication.
